Justin and Snark delve into the high-budgeted films clashing at the box office this summer. With films like The Flash, Transformers: Rise of the Beasts, Elemental, The Little Mermaid, Fast X, and even Spider-Man: Across the Spider-Verse (which is enjoying success), the question is, are there too many movies vying for audience attention simultaneously? Could it be due to mixed reception or the overwhelming cost of watching multiple movies in theaters? And what does all of this mean for upcoming releases like Indiana Jones and the Dial of Destiny, Oppenheimer, and Barbie? Should Hollywood be concerned?
